OverviewOverwhelmed by money management advice? Sift through the clutter with eight simple lessons. From smarter spending choices to simplified investment decisions, learn how to better manage your money. Based on research and her own experiences after leaving home when she was eighteen and retiring at age forty-one, the author learned which choices matter most to your finances. This book reveals those insights. If you could take small steps to live smarter, would you? In thirty minutes, this handbook will teach you foundational knowledge to control your money, and not let it control your life. Now is the time to reclaim your financial wits.
